Transaction 33c2561038d3dce3b23bdd14f31c28601767c241fff7655f3ec17e1bb2a35643

1 Input
2 Outputs
  • 33c2561038d3dce3b23bdd14f31c28601767c241fff7655f3ec17e1bb2a35643:0
  • value  41085
    address  bc1q7ae84kht4jv4r82rxp8mfjyeuulfc9ujs0zzgc
  • 33c2561038d3dce3b23bdd14f31c28601767c241fff7655f3ec17e1bb2a35643:1
  • value  69489
    address  38SsNnG86YnfwDvRfvkCt2vhUsXCiMVMEn